LOOP End Definition of DO/LOOP Loop
DO [{WHILE | UNTIL} expression]
.
. [statements]
.
[EXIT LOOP]
[LOOP | WEND] [{WHILE | UNTIL} expression]
Terminates the definition of a DO/LOOP loop.
expression A numeric expression. Nonzero values are equivalent to
TRUE, while zero values are equivalent to FALSE.
WHILE Causes execution of the loop as long as expression is
TRUE.
UNTIL Causes execution of the loop as long as expression is
FALSE.
EXIT LOOP An optional means to escape from the loop before its LOOP
| WEND termination.
LOOP | WEND Terminates the loop construct. LOOP and WEND are synonyms
in this context, but one or the other must be provided to
match each DO statement.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------
Notes: DO...LOOP is a general-purpose looping construct. The
termination test may be supplied at the beginning, at the
end, at both places, or at neither.
